Lorraine Woods has been promoted to the role of chief investment and operations officer at Atomic 212, the media agency owned by Publicis.
Her responsibilities include modernizing agency processes, implementing innovative platforms and technology, and fostering an efficient, unified operational culture across key business functions such as talent management and resourcing.
Woods will report directly to Atomic’s CEO, Rory Heffernan. Additionally, the agency’s general managers from Adelaide, Brisbane, Melbourne, and Darwin will now report to her.
